The Herbalist Council of Malawi says banning traditional doctors in the country cannot end attacks on people with albinism.

The development follows suggestions that traditional doctors should be banned as one way of ending the barbaric acts in Malawi that have left people with albinism living in fear.

The attacks follow a false myth that albino parts can bring luck monetary wise, with the herbalists taking part in preparing charms.

African-medicineReacting to the development, Herbalists Council of Malawi General Secretary Robins Zanizo said they are not behind the killings arguing that those perpetrating the malpractice are not traditional doctors.

“Most Malawians believe in traditional medicine because there are some disease that cannot be cured with medication from hospitals. I think banning traditional doctors will not solve the problem,” said Zanizo.

Zanizo added that the council is to work hand in hand with government to ensure perpetrators are brought into book.

The song of killing people living with albinism has been echoing in Malawians’ ears for more than two years despite authorities speaking tough against the malpractice.
